The following statistics were released by the Department of Health:

Dental Reform Monitoring for quarter ending June 2008. This data shows the number of Units of Dental Activity (UDAs) commissioned for 2008-09 as at 30th June 2008.

Key findings this quarter:

-- 152 of the 152 Commissioners (PCTs and Care Trusts) returned data.
-- 81 million UDAs have been commissioned for 2008-09 as at 30th June 2008.
-- This represents an increase of 1.4 million (1.7%) on the UDAs commissioned for 2007-08.
